The length of the segment from a point c _____ to the line AB gives the distance from point c to the line ab brainly

Mathematics
1 answer:
guapka [62]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

A. Perpendicular

Step-by-step explanation:

When lines and/or points are in perpendicular to one another, the perpendicularity line between them measures the distance between both points and/or lines.

So to measure the distance between point c and line AB, a perpendicular line has to be drawn from c to AB or from AB to c. Either of these will arrive at the same result.

It should also be noted that the angle at the point of intersection of perpendicular lines is 90°.
